Jim Mitchell for Model Number KUDM01TJBT0

Hello. The nice lady on the phone told me to ask you my ? My control panel was 8530909 the new one I bought is 8564543. they are not even close. the old 1 has a bank of 4 terminals for power and a bank of 4 right beside it. It also has 2 flat blade terminals on the very front. the new 1 does not have either of these.The new 1 has 3 terminals at the back of the unit. Do I need an electrician to rewire something? Please HELP and THANX in advance. Jim

1 Answer

Jim, No you shouldn't need and electrician to rewire something. Several Dishwasher control boards now "substitue" to the WP8564543 / 8564543, including the 8530909. The replacement part should be a "straight across" replacement with one exception " Per Factory This Sub Should Only Have 3 Terminals The P4(Y). Terminal Which Was On The Oriiginal Control Has Been Removed and Not Used On This Control." You'll want to take the P4 connector and some electical tape, and tape the connector back to the wire harness, so it's out of the way and not in contact with the control or metal components. You should be fine from there on out.
